Using benchmarking techniques to improve efficiency and quality in cardiology services: Part one.
1SunHealth Alliance, Charlotte, NC.
This paper discusses the need for standardized indicators in cardiology services. The authors suggest that benchmarking can help identify best practices and areas for improvement. They propose that these indicators should cover both clinical and nonclinical aspects of cardiology programs. The study does not provide specific metrics but emphasizes the need for industry consensus. The main finding is that benchmarking is a valuable tool for improving cardiology services. The authors do not claim that benchmarking is the only solution but propose it as a starting point. The paper highlights the importance of comparing performance across different cardiology programs. The conclusion is that standardized indicators are essential for measuring effectiveness in cardiology services.

Background:
Prior research has shown that benchmarking is a useful tool in various healthcare fields. However, cardiology lacks standardized indicators for measuring clinical and nonclinical effectiveness. This gap motivated the need to explore how benchmarking could be applied within cardiology services. Existing studies have established benchmarking as a method for performance evaluation. Yet, no prior work had resolved how to tailor this approach specifically for cardiology. The absence of industry-accepted indicators limits the ability to compare cardiology programs effectively. This uncertainty drives the need for a structured benchmarking process in the field. Establishing such indicators could help identify best practices and areas needing improvement. The challenge remains in defining what metrics are most relevant and actionable for cardiology services.
